当前位置 : 主页 > 编程语言 > python >

如何解决Python的代码块嵌套深度错误?

来源:互联网 收集:自由互联 发布时间:2023-07-29
Python作为一门高级编程语言,其语法结构的复杂性难免会让初学者感到困惑。其中一个常见的问题就是代码块嵌套深度错误,也就是所谓的“缩进错误”。 当你按照规范完成Python代码时

Python作为一门高级编程语言,其语法结构的复杂性难免会让初学者感到困惑。其中一个常见的问题就是代码块嵌套深度错误,也就是所谓的“缩进错误”。

当你按照规范完成Python代码时,遇到这种情况的概率应该很小。然而,当你遇到这种问题时,可以试着从以下几个方面来解决。

  1. 规范化你的缩进

Python代码块通过缩进来定义,缩进必须使用空格、制表符或者两者混合的形式,但是不推荐使用制表符。规范化你的缩进可以帮助你避免深度嵌套的错误,同时也能让代码可读性更高。

  1. 使用合适的编辑器

目前市面上有很多优秀的Python编辑器,这些编辑器都具有很多的功能,比如代码折叠、自动缩进等等。使用这些编辑器可以帮助你更好地维护代码的结构,同时也可以自动检测并修复缩进错误。

  1. 使用代码规范检查工具

除了手动检查之外,你可以使用一些代码规范检查工具来自动排查缩进错误。这些工具会对你的Python代码文件进行分析,然后生成清晰明了的错误报告,让你更快地发现缩进问题并及时修复。

  1. 找到各种缩进错误的示例并进行分析

在你学习Python时,需要积累一些缩进错误的示例并进行分析。可以通过尝试一些错误的例子并将其改正来更好地理解Python的代码块嵌套深度问题。一旦你熟悉了它们,就已经掌握了避免这些使你深陷缩进错误的陷阱的方法了。

末尾总结

在Python中,代码块的嵌套深度经常导致代码问题,特别是在你开始应用所有的编码技巧和技能时。但是,只要你认真遵守语法规范,并使用适当的工具,缩进错误并不是很难解决的问题。如果你刚开始学习Python,可以多尝试各种情况,并保持对这类问题的关注,那么你最终会看到该语言的真正潜能。

上一篇:浅析Python装饰器中的@property
下一篇:没有了
网友评论